Footballer-turned-pundit Paul Merson has selected his Chelsea-Arsenal combined starting lineup.

The Blues host Arsenal at Stamford Bridge on Sunday, kick-off is scheduled for 13:30 (GMT).

Surprisingly, Merson has struggled to fit in any Arsenal player in his combined line-up. Chile international Alexis Sanchez – who came close to a deadline day exit – is they only Gunner to be included.

Merson left Mesut Ozil out of his squad in favour of Belgium international playmaker Eden Hazard.

“I’ve picked a 3-4-2-1 as that’s what both sides have been playing so I don’t know if Mesut Ozil would fit into that system,” Merson told SkySports.

“Ozil certainly doesn’t get in ahead of Hazard and I don’t think many Arsenal fans would put him in ahead of Sanchez.

“I’ve picked a team to win a football match, not a fantasy side based on technical ability.”

Ozil – along with six other first team players – was left out of Arsenal’s squad which took ok FC Koln on Thursday night in the Europa League.

Manager Arsene Wenger decided to rest his star names in preparation for this weekends London derby with Chelsea.

Arsenal defeated Chelsea in the FA Cup final late last season and in the FA Community Shield Final last month.

Chelsea come into the game in impressive form following three back-to-back wins.
